Ace is an album by Grateful Dead singer and guitarist Bob Weir. His first solo album, it was released in 1972. It is essentially a Grateful Dead album, as almost all of the members of The Grateful Dead at the time played on it. The album's origins were an offer by the Dead's Warner Bros. Records label to have band members cut their own solo records, and it came out the same year as Jerry Garcia's Garcia and Mickey Hart's Rolling Thunder.
